摘要
The invention relates to a method and a device based on the application of an active corrective system with central corrector and Youla parameter for the attenuation of essentially single-frequency mechanical vibration disturbances created in a material structure by a rotating machine. Previously, a correction control law corresponding to a block modeling of the system is established and calculated, said blocks being, on the one hand, those of the central corrector and, on the other hand, a parameter block of Youla, the modeling being such that only the Youla parameter, in the form of an infinite impulse response filter, has coefficients depending on the vibratory perturbation frequency. During a use phase, in real time, the frequency of the current disturbance is determined and the correction control law is calculated by using for the Youla parameter the stored coefficients of a determined perturbation frequency corresponding to the current frequency of disturbance.
